Ironing device with textile fabric tension adjusting function
A tension adjustment and ironing device technology, applied in the field of textile fabrics, can solve the problems of inability to perform tension adjustment, continuous ironing effect, single work energy, etc., and achieves improved ironing efficiency, ironing automation, and obvious ironing effect.
